PRISM is JSU's information management system that stores and reports operational goals, objectives, strategies, methods of assessment/evaluation, and use of results. Operational and learning goals, objectives, and results are entered into this online system. Annual reports with significant accomplishments included in PRISM provide summary data. PRISM provides decision makers with relevant reports, making JSU's comprehensive system of continuous improvement visible, viable, and meaningful. Planning and Reporting Timeline

Reporting Year

October 15 All units complete reporting by completing:
  • Results of Evaluation/Assessment
  • Use of Results
  • Status Boxes for Each Objective

Planning Year

December 15 All units revise/develop and enter into PRISM their plans with goals, objectives, evaluation strategies and new funding requests for the year.
February 1 Deans/AVPs review, revise, and approve unit plan and requests.
March 1 Vice Presidents review and approve/disapprove unit plans and budget requests.
